Bosnia and Herzegovina join the Horizon Europe programme

Photo from the Signing
Mariya Gabriel, Commissioner for Innovation, Research, Culture, Education and Youth and Ankica Gudeljevic, Minister of Civil Affairs of Bosnia and Herzegovina

Following the joint signatures of Commissioner Gabriel and Minister Ankica Gudeljevic, Minister of Civil Affairs of Bosnia and Herzegovina, and the exchange of required Notes Verbales, the Horizon Europe Association Agreement with Bosnia and Herzegovina became provisionally applicable on 11 January 2022. The Agreement applies with a retroactive effects as from 1 January 2021, the start of Horizon Europe Programme.

This means, that Bosnia and Herzegovina:

  • is now formally a Horizon Europe Associated Country
  • its respective legal entities have the status of entities from an Associated Country, and Grant Agreements can be signed with them
  • its representatives can be invited to all governance structures implementing the programme and participate as observers in the JRC Board of Governors
  • its National Contact Points (NCPs) are fully included in all activities of the NCPs network
